Movies like Ready Player One, ranked

1. Tron (1982)

A hacker thrust into a neon digital arena must outmaneuver a tyrannical program through high-stakes games, echoing the same retro arcade aesthetics and competitive survival stakes that define the treasure hunt.

2. The One (2001)

Jet Li's pursuit across parallel realities mirrors the escalating stakes and video-game-like progression of collecting power-ups, where each victory brings the protagonist closer to an ultimate confrontation.

3. Tron: Legacy (2010)

Both explore digital worlds with neon-soaked aesthetics and father-son mythology, but Tron: Legacy intensifies the stakes by trapping its protagonist inside the system where he must survive gladiatorial combat and face a godlike antagonist ruling through absolute control.

4. The Thirteenth Floor (1999)

The Thirteenth Floor layers nested virtual realities with the same mind-bending puzzle-box structure, where protagonists must decode the rules of simulated worlds to uncover hidden truths that challenge their understanding of reality itself.

5. Outerworld (2018)

The cyberpunk aesthetics and high-stakes race between scrappy underdogs and corporate villains competing for control of a transformative technology mirrors the treasure-hunt urgency that drives the narrative.

6. The Running Man (2025)

The high-stakes competition against a powerful corporation uses the same scaffolding of a rigged game show where survival depends on outsmarting both the system and the ruthless hunters determined to eliminate you.

7. The Matrix (1999)

This film explores the same collision between virtual simulation and authentic reality, using elaborate action sequences and visual spectacle to interrogate what it means to exist within constructed worlds.

8. Primer (2004)

This mind-bending exploration of unintended consequences uses nested realities and increasingly complex rules as its central puzzle, much like decoding layered virtual worlds to claim an ultimate prize.
